    Hey all! I just found this site today, and my Maverick was delivered yesterday! Talk about luck... Anyway, It's a 1974 with the 250 engine and auto trannie. The engine is blown, the kid that had it ran it out of oil, so I'm told it knocks pretty bad. :mad: So, I'm still seeing if its a 'replace' or a 'fix' situation. Either way, I'm proud of my $400.00 project!!! I look forward to fixing it up and am ever so grateful to having found this site!!!
